    Hmm...worst performance in 2012?

    I disagree with Conway. Remember, Foyt hasn't won a race in a unified series since I want to say 1978. Don't hold me to that exact year but its been a while. Foyt never won in CART, and won in the IRL against weaker teams. No driver has done well there of late, and I think Sato and Foyt are going to be a disastrous pairing.

    As for drivers, Barrichello was a disappointment. I really thought he would be better. Marco was disappointing too. I think only one finish better than 8th.

    However, if I had to offer one disappointment beyond all else, I'd say Lotus. Certainly, I knew they'd be #3 to Chevy and Honda. But the pathetic way they ran the revered Lotus through the mud was, beyond disappointing.

    Graham, Ruebens and Marco.

    Graham did so bad that he lost his ride at Ganassi. Ruebens did so bad, he lost his sponsorship and ride with KV, and certainly was not worth the $2 mil he demanded.

    Marco continues to struggle. His melt down in the 500, and his tantrums have stunted his development. Out shined by RHR and Hinch, he would be long gone if not for Daddy.

    Of the three, Graham and Marco should have done better with the team and resources they had. Both have potential, but both need to look in the mirror, and dig deep to re-establish their careers. Both, are very young, so they could recover.
